MC RichardsGreat Valley to celebrate master potter Richards's life 

5/1/2013 Penn State Great Valley will hold a celebration of the life of master potter M.C. Richards from 6 to 9 p.m., Thursday, May 16, in The Conference Center at Penn State Great Valley, 30 E. Swedesford Rd., Malvern. Richards's life as a poet, potter, teacher and mystical philosopher will be displayed through an exhibit of her work, a viewing of the documentary "M.C. Richards: The Fire Within" and a discussion of her local connections from the last years of her life. This is a free event, but registration is required.

Penn State Great Valley provides free career workshop for area professionals 

4/23/13 "Job Search and You," sponsored by the Chester County Workforce Investment Board and Great Valley's Office of Continuing Professional Education, is a program designed to provide career assistance to Chester County residents through the Managing Your Career Transition conferences. This year's event will be held 8 a.m. to noon, Friday, May 17, The Conference Center, 30 E. Swedesford Rd., Malvern. The conference will include a panel of human resource professionals who will discuss résumé preparation, the job interview process and using web tools for employment searches. Additional career counseling and networking opportunities will follow the presentation. Attendance is free to eligible participants. Check website for eligibility requirements or to register.
